The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C) will construct seven 23-story towers to rehabilitate Project Affected People (PAP) who have been displaced by the ambitious Goregaon-Mulund Link Road (GMLR) project. The Mumbai local government will construct these seven structures along Lal Bahadur Shashtri (LBS) Marg, in the direction of Kanjurmarg, to house the approximately 800 families that have been identified as PAPs suitable for rehabilitation.
 
The Goregaon-Mulund Link Road (GMLR) is a fourth main link that connects the eastern and western suburbs and is being built in four sections. Sanjay Gandhi National Park (SGNP) would be crossed by the 12.2-kilometer GMLR with twin tunnels. According to BMC officials, the project's construction will have an impact on families in Bhandup's Khindipada area and Goregaon's Film City.
 
"The rehabilitation of roughly 660 resident families, 51 commercial structures, and around 100 impoverished families are necessary for the construction of GMLR. Construction of seven ground plus 23-story buildings on the property at LBS Marg, Kanjur (West) in 'S' Ward (Bhandup, Kanjurmarg, and sections of Powai) is suggested for PAP rehabilitation "According to a BMC official. Work on an underpass across the Western Express Highway near Oberoi mall in Goregaon and a second-level flyover across the Eastern Express Highway at Airoli Junction will be completed in the fourth phase.
